Common Comcast Email Issues

The most common issues that Comcast email users face include login problems, sending or receiving emails, spam emails, attachment issues, and many others. For instance, a user may have trouble logging into their Comcast email account due to an incorrect password or forgotten username.

Alternatively, a user may not be able to send or receive emails due to server downtime or device compatibility issues. Identifying the specific issue is crucial to resolving it.

Basic Troubleshooting Steps

Before jumping to advanced troubleshooting steps, it is essential to perform basic troubleshooting steps. These steps may help fix most Comcast email problems. The basic steps include checking the internet connection, clearing the cache and cookies, restarting the device, and ensuring that the browser is up-to-date.

It is also advisable to check if other devices can access the internet or send/receive emails, as the issue may be device-specific.

Troubleshooting Comcast Email Login Issues

Comcast email login issues are common, but they can be frustrating. If you have forgotten your username or password, you can reset them by clicking on the “Forgot Password” or “Forgot Username” link on the login page. Follow the instructions provided to reset your password or recover your username. It is essential to ensure that you have entered the correct login credentials and that your account is active.

Troubleshooting Comcast Email Sending or Receiving Issues

Sending or receiving emails is the primary function of an email account. Therefore, if you encounter issues with sending or receiving emails, it can be frustrating. Common reasons for this issue include incorrect email server settings, firewall or antivirus software blocking emails, or exceeding the email attachment size limit.

To troubleshoot this issue, you can check the email server settings, disable the antivirus software, or compress the files before attaching them.

Troubleshooting Comcast Email Spam or Junk Email Issues

Spam or junk emails can be annoying and clutter your inbox. Comcast email provides a spam filter that automatically detects spam and sends it to the spam folder. However, some spam emails may still find their way into your inbox.

To mark an email as spam, select the email and click on the “Mark as Spam” option. To block an email address, select the email and click on the “Block Sender” option. You can also configure the spam filter settings to ensure that only relevant emails reach your inbox.

Troubleshooting Comcast Email Attachment Issues

Attachment issues are common among email users, and Comcast email users are no exception. These issues may arise due to the size or type of the attached file. To troubleshoot attachment issues, you can compress the file, change the file format, or use cloud storage to send large files.

Troubleshooting Comcast Email Not Working Issues

Sometimes, Comcast email may stop working entirely. The cause of this issue may be server downtime or device compatibility issues. To check if the Comcast email server is working, you can visit the official Comcast status page. You can also update the device software or contact Comcast support for further assistance.

Configuring Email Server Settings Manually

If the email server settings are incorrect, you may encounter issues with sending or receiving emails. To configure the email server settings manually, you need to locate the server settings on your device and enter the correct values. The incoming server settings are as follows:

  • Server: imap.comcast.net
  • Port: 993
  • Encryption: SSL/TLS

The outgoing server settings are as follows:

  • Server: smtp.comcast.net
  • Port: 587
  • Encryption: STARTTLS/TLS

Checking Firewall Settings

If the firewall settings are blocking Comcast email, you may need to adjust them to allow incoming and outgoing email traffic. To check the firewall settings, you can visit the device settings and locate the firewall or security settings. Ensure that the firewall is not blocking incoming or outgoing email traffic.
